Spaghetti Squash with Meat Sauce

All the taste of traditional spaghetti and meat sauce, but without all the carbs. You'll have a hard time telling the difference, it's that good!! If you have a favorite spaghetti sauce recipe, by all means use it for this.

Ingredients

  • What you'll need:
  • Spaghetti Squash
  • Meat Sauce (recipe below, ingredient amounts approx.)
  • Grated Parmesan cheese (think green can)
  • Shredded mozzarella cheese
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• Garnishes: crushed red peppers and chopped parsley
  • Meat Sauce:
  • 1/2 pound lean ground beef (93/7)
  • 3 tablespoons Hunt's tomato paste
  • 1 (24 oz) can Hunt's 'Traditional' Pasta Sauce
  • 1 teaspoon dried chopped onions
  • 1/2 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• 1/4 teaspoon dried basil
  • Pinch gar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on sugar
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Details

Preparation

Step 1

In a saucepan or Dutch oven, brown ground beef while breaking it up in small pieces; season with a little salt and pepper. When meat is done, add the tomato paste, stirring well to combine.

Add the remaining ingredients (amounts to taste) and simmer over low heat for at least 30 minutes (or more) for flavors to blend and sauce to thicken.

To serve:
Cut squash in half, remove seedy center, then microwave each half in a covered dish for 8-9 minutes or until tender.
Shred the squash into "spaghetti" strands with a fork. Season with salt and pepper. Sprinkle with parmesan cheese and some meat sauce, lifting strands to incorporate.
To finish, top with more meat sauce, more parmesan, and shredded mozzarella.

Microwave about 2 minutes to melt the cheese. Garnish with crushed red peppers and parsley if desired and serve immediately.
